In preparing a root canal for obturation, the most important consideration is

A. general health of the patient.
B. cleaning and shaping of the canal.
C. efficacy of the irrigating solution.
D. amount and concentration of medication used.
E. sterilization of the canal as evidenced by negative culture.

Final answer:

The most important consideration in preparing a root canal for obturation is the cleaning and shaping of the canal, which is fundamental in removing infection and preventing recurrence.

Step-by-step explanation:

In answering the question regarding the most important consideration in preparing a root canal for obturation, the emphasis is placed on B. cleaning and shaping of the canal. This step is crucial because it ensures the removal of infected tissue, debris, and bacteria, which provides a clean environment for the sealing and filling materials to adhere properly. While the general health of the patient, the efficacy of the irrigating solution, the amount and concentration of medication used, and the sterilization of the canal as evidenced by negative culture are all significant aspects of endodontic therapy, the success of a root canal treatment heavily relies on proper cleaning and shaping to minimize the risk of infection recurrence and ensure a conducive environment for healing.
